How Hardwood Floor Water Extraction Actually Works
Our team’s process for Hardwood Floor Water Extraction is designed to be efficient and effective. We understand that every minute counts with water damage. Our technicians will arrive quickly and assess the damage to find out the best course of action.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ll assess the damage and create a plan to extract the water and dry your floors. Our team will use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the water from your floors.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as soon as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your floors and dehumidify the air.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th and ensuring your floors are completely dry.
Step 4: Inspection and Cleaning
Our team will inspect your floors to ensure they’re completely dry and free of damage. We’ll also clean your floors to remove any dirt or debris that may have been dislodged during the extraction process.
Step 5: Disinfection and Sanitizing
We’ll disinfect and sanitize your floors to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This step is crucial in maintaining a healthy and safe environment in your home.

Hardwood Floor Water Extraction Cost In Carbonado, WA
The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Extraction in Carbonado,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Inspection and C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ring |
